Source states the density is relative to that of water at 4°C.

Conclusions:
The density of tripotassium orthophosphate at 17°C relative to that of water at 4°C was found to be 2.56.

Specific gravity is a type of relative density in which the substance density is compared to that of water at 3.98°C. Value has been rounded down from 2.564.

Conclusions:
The specific gravity of tripotassium orthophosphate at 17°C (relative to that of water at 3.98°C) was found to be 2.56.

Description of key information

In accordance with Annex XI, Section 1.2. of Regulation (EC) No. 1907/2006 (REACH) a weight of evidence approach has been used to fulfil the endpoint '7.4. Relative density'. Taken together these data are considered to be acceptable to fulfil the endpoint as part of a weight of evidence and no further testing is considered to be justified.

Key value for chemical safety assessment

Additional information

The density of tripotassium orthophosphate at 17°C was reported to be 2.56.
